FARRAR v. STATE

No. 2-92-485-CR.

865 S.W.2d 607 (1993)

Jimmie Dewayne FARRAR, Appellant, v. The STATE of Texas, State.

Court of Appeals of Texas, Fort Worth.

November 10, 1993.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

R. Kelton Conner, Granbury, for appellant.

Richard L. Hattox, Dist. Atty., Granbury, for appellee.

Before FARRIS, HICKS and FARRAR, JJ.


OPINION

FARRIS, Justice.

Jimmie Dewayne Farrar was convicted of driving while intoxicated, subsequent offense. TEX.REV.CIV.STAT.ANN. art. 6701l-1 (Vernon Supp.1993). The jury found the alleged enhancement counts were true and assessed Farrar's punishment at two years confinement and a fine of $2,000.
